Output 39bc2fe17a2ba2a4229a0bfa780ff37a30d3ffeb3911533a5cd563a0340f1ebc:0

value
3058624
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d8c796a2e13fac86e4a8fa609c18b8d64faf34c OP_EQUALVERIFY OP_CHECKSIG
address
1MCScifZT229BJfP4aq5B9Cwg8yacrdaPi
transaction
39bc2fe17a2ba2a4229a0bfa780ff37a30d3ffeb3911533a5cd563a0340f1ebc
spent
true